Transaction 381514ef4cdfb3168086e7e4f43564f5dd0dccd527783f03c433fc90d5a28358
1 Input
1 Output
-
381514ef4cdfb3168086e7e4f43564f5dd0dccd527783f03c433fc90d5a28358:0
- value
- 1073017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2aae992452b0cd343db25eda736a2170ab44f4d OP_EQUAL
- address
- 3Pp8CAgARANWM5i6Kmie8U1JTkSBHnabeS